About this collection

This is a curated 8-part collection of community-verified endgame blueprints for Arknights: Endfield's Automation Industrial Complex. Each part covers a specific factory archetype — Valley IV mega-base, V4 PAC modules, Wuling Xiranite hybrids, and event-specific Palm-Top Savior builds — with copy-paste blueprint codes for both Asia and NA/EU servers. Codes import directly into the in-game blueprint slot.

The collection is ordered roughly by progression: Part 1 is the recommended starting endgame factory, parts 2–5 are deeper optimizations and v1.2 refreshes, and parts 6–7 cover event-only layouts. Pick the part that matches your current tech tier and material stockpile — every blueprint page documents what it produces (e.g., 18/min Buck A, 47,640 bills/hr), so you can compare expected output against your investment cost before committing to a rebuild.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does a 'blueprint code' actually do when I import it in-game?

An in-game blueprint code is a long string the game serializes from a saved factory layout. When you paste it into the blueprint import slot, the game reconstructs the exact placement, rotation, and recipe assignment for every building in that blueprint — provided you have the materials and tech unlocks. The code does not magically grant you the buildings; you still need to own all the required structures and pay the placement cost. Think of it as a copy-paste for layouts, not a cheat for materials.

Why are there separate codes for Asia and NA/EU servers?

Hypergryph runs separate game servers (Asia vs Global/NA-EU) with independent account databases and, occasionally, slightly different patch versions. Blueprint codes embed a server identifier so the game can verify the code belongs to your server before importing. If you paste an Asia code into NA/EU (or vice versa), the import fails. Both codes are included on every blueprint page in this collection — pick the one matching your active account, and bookmark the page you reference most often.

Should I start with Part 1 or jump to a later part?

Start with Part 1 (Valley IV) if you have just unlocked the AIC and are looking for your first endgame factory. Each later part assumes you have the prerequisite tech unlocks and a baseline of materials — Part 5 (Wuling 1.2.1 Mega Base) in particular needs Tier 3+ pylons and a sustained Wuling fuel supply. The parts are roughly progression-ordered: 1–3 build core endgame, 4 covers a v1.2 refresh, 5 maxes outpost profits, 6–7 cover event-specific blueprints (Palm-Top Savior).

Will these blueprints still work after a patch updates building stats?

Mostly yes. Patches that adjust building throughput (e.g., a Refining Unit ratio change) can shift the optimal ratio in a blueprint slightly, but the layout still functions — you just produce a few percent less than the headline number on the original guide. Patches that add new buildings or recipes don't break existing blueprints, they just open new optimization opportunities. The collection is refreshed after major version changes; Part 4 was specifically updated for v1.2 to address such ratio shifts.

Are these blueprints from a single creator or aggregated?

Each part credits its source community designer (typically posted to r/Endfield, the official Discord, or a creator's personal blog). The collection here aggregates blueprints we have personally verified work as advertised on both Asia and NA/EU servers. Where the source designer published a specific name for the build — 'Wuling 1.2.1 Max Profit Mega Base', 'Sky King Flat' — we preserve it so you can cross-reference back to the original creator's content and updates.
